it was a standard security system installed to prevent theft of the truck if the right key wasn't inserted into the the lock cylinder the tumblers wouldn't engage and the ecm wouldn't receive the correct signal and the truck would set there and crank until the battery went dead so i'm not saying that it IS bad i'm just saying it's something to check out if you have fuel and spark. also you say you have good spark is it a nice blue or kinda a bluish yellow?
